Pagina´s samenstellen

Status
Niet open voor verdere reacties.

Toegang

Gebruiker
Lid geworden
10 jun 2003
Berichten
58
De mainpage heeft een menu, met header en footer. De sub- en subsub-paginas hebben allemaal de zelfde header en footer, maar zijn verschillend in lengte --> ik wil geen frames gebruiken maar ook niet die header en footer 20 keer kopieren om vervolgens als ik iets wil veranderen dat ook weer 20 keer moet doen. Hoe pak ik dit aan ?
 
Heb je php ondersteuning?
Dan is het makkelijk, je include gewoon de header en footer

:cool:.
 
Ik weet niet of je php ondersteuning hebt..

Zoja:

dan kun je op iedere pagina dit regeltje zetten:


<?php
include_once("header.html");
?>

Hier komt je pagina


<?php
include_once("footer.html");
?>


Dit zorgt ervoor dat op iedere pagina die 2 bestandjes geladen wordt.. in de plaats van "Hier komt je pagina" kun je gewoon je pagina maken..

Alleen 1 ding.. je moet wel al je bestanden van .html hernoemen naar .php anders werkt het niet.

Dit werkt dus alleen als je php ondersteuning hebt :)

Edit: te laat :p
 
Dank jullie wel, maar ik begrijp het niet helemaal. Graag iets meer uitleg,

alvast bedankt.
Toegang
 
Uitleg en werken met php tref je hier:
http://www.essetee.be/windex.php


Header en footer als terugkerend item op je pagina kan met de include funktie van php.

Daartoe maak je gewoon met je editor een normale pagina.
Is dit goed dan splits je je pagina in drie parten.
header.php content.php en footer php

Dus je hebt nu drie pagina's.
Je maakt nu een nieuwe pagina naam.php
en hierin roep je de header.php en footer.php aan.
Je content zet je gewoon op de juiste plek.
Met andere woorden:
je pagina is gelijk een normale html pagina, doch de codes voor header en footer worden vervangen door de includes.

Voor iedere pagina die je nu maakt doe je hetzelfde.

Moet de header (ander plaatje) gewijzigd worden, dan hoef je alleen de header.php aan te passen.
Door de includes in alle pagina's verschijnt de nieuwe header vanzelf.

Google:

http://www.google.com/search?hl=en&...n-US&q=include+php+hoe-doe-je-dat&btnG=Search

:cool:
 
GEEN php / inmiddels wel

Helaas blijkt dat ik geen php ondersteuning heb, hhoe los ik het dan op?

Gelukkig heb ik inmiddels een server die wel php ondersteund! Ik probeer het meteen uit en daarmee is de vraag opgelost.

Dank jullie wel.
 
Laatst bewerkt:
Status
Niet open voor verdere reacties.
Terug
Bovenaan Onderaan